Teriyaki Green Bean Ideas and Variations

Modify green beans with soy sauce and mirin to fit your needs. Try these different variations:

  • Soy sauce - try tamari or coconut aminos for gluten free or soy free
  • Mirin - try a touch of white or red vinegar and a wee bit of sugar or leave it out and focus on the soy sauce and sesame oil.
  • Ginger - buy pre-grated ginger or add a dash of ground ginger instead or leave it out.
  • Toasted Sesame Oil - use whatever oil
  • Add ons: cilantro, basil, sliced green onions, sesame seeds, jalapeños
  • Make it spicy: add red chili flakes, sriracha, or chili oil

Quick and Easy Teriyaki Green Beans

This quick and easy teriyaki green beans recipe is cooked in a soy sauce, mirin, and ginger sauce and has a hint of toasted sesame oil. Side dish is ready in 15 minutes.

  • Prep Time: 5 minutes
  • Cook Time: 10 minutes
  • Total Time: 15 minutes
  • Yield: 4
  • Category: Side Dish
  • Method: Stovetop
  • Cuisine: Asian
  • Diet: Vegan

Ingredients

  • 1 lb green beans, ends trimmed
  • 2 tablespoon soy sauce
  • 2 tablespoon mirin
  • 2 teaspoon minced ginger
  • dash toasted sesame oil - add to taste as sesame oil has a strong taste
  • salt to taste

Instructions

  • Bring a pot of salted water to a boil.
  • Add green beans and simmer uncovered until desired tenderness (5-10 minutes).
  • Strain water and add green beans back to pot.
  • Stir in remaining ingredients and simmer 3-5 minutes until coated with sauce and hot.
  • Add salt to taste.

Notes

  • Add some heat - try sriracha, chili flakes, or chili crisp oil.
